**Scheduling Responsibilities**
- Assist the management team in planning, and coordinating construction activities including crew and equipment
- Establish, monitor and updates construction work schedule in Quickbooks Time
- Assist with approval of employee hours
- Assist with management and coordination of subcontractors and out of town lodging
- Participate in scheduling and planning meetings
- Collaborate with foreman to support all crewing and project needs
- Identify changes to the project schedule and its impacts (e.g. contract impact)
- Interface with customers to provide project status reports and ensure customer needs are met
**Safety & Site Responsibilities**
- Ensure compliance with the Occupational Health & Safety Act and Regulations for construction projects and submit relevant documentation
- Complete and verify site measurements as required
- Attend pre-tender site visits and review existing site conditions
- Provide scope of work clarification to construction teams and clients
- Assist in reviewing operator’s daily safety paperwork
- Perform random onsite safety audits
**Estimating Responsibilities**
- Work closely with Estimating Manager/Project Manager
- Actively obtain tender documents from online bid posting sites
- Review tender specifications, drawings, Geotech reports, subcontract documents
- Identify all potential contract risks and liaison with Estimator/PM for advice
- Perform quantity calculations and full take-offs for relative tender items
- Follow-up and provide tender results
- Provide estimating and project management back-up as required
- Manage monthly cumulative costing reports
- Perform such other duties and responsibilities as assigned by the supervisor/manager
**Working Conditions**
- Standard 50 hours per week
- Daily exposure to construction environment i.e. heavy equipment, oncoming traffic, inclement weather (heat, cold, rain etc.)
